Hence, the time complexity is denoted as O(n). Instructions Select the checkboxes under theBig O NotationGraph on to view graphs of common algorithm complexities. As well, choose a complexity from the drop down menu on the right to view an explanation about it. ...
As a result of this, the expression to represent the complexity for this algorithm would be t * n, however, since t is a constant, it should be omitted. Hence, the time complexity is denoted as O(n).Instructions Select the checkboxes under the Big O Notation Graph on to view graphs ...
BigO Notation Examples python computer-science algorithms bubble-sort big-o time-complexity linear-search basic-programming Updated May 2, 2019 Python MitinPavel / ctci_rust Star 3 Code Issues Pull requests Rust solutions for Cracking the Coding Interview book rust algorithm interview-questions...
Engineers can get a visual graph that shows needs relative to different input sizes. Big O notation is also used in other kinds of measurements in other fields. It is an example of a fundamental equation with a lot of parameters and variables. A full notation of the big O notation ...
O(1) - array indexO(n) - foreach arrayO(log n) - binary searchO(n log n) - merge sortO(n²) - foreach inside foreach (squared)O(n³) - foreach inside foreach inside foreach (cubic)O(2^n) - fibanachiO(n!) - go throuth graph ...
Note:Big-O notation is one of the measures used for algorithmic complexity. Some others include Big-Theta and Big-Omega. Big-Omega, Big-Theta, and Big-O are intuitively equal to thebest,average, andworsttime complexity an algorithm can achieve. We typically use Big-O as a measure, instead...
Compiled by Dale back in 1996, it has a lot of wonderful graphics inspired by John Keely and Nikola Tesla with a turn-of-the-century flair about the links between musical notation and colors. A wonderful inspiration for possible laser patterns and tuning algorithms, but the formulations need ...
Here is a graph that can serve as a cheat sheet until you get to know the Big O Notation better: As the size of the input increases, you can take a visual look to see how the number of operations increases. This will give you a sense of what an efficient runtime is for more ...
Big O notationis a mathematicalnotationthat describes the limiting behavior of a function when the argument tends towards a particular value or infinity. It is a member of a family ofnotationsinvented by Paul Bachmann, Edmund Landau, and others, collectively called Bachmann–Landaunotationor asymptoti...
Big-O Complexity Chart HorribleBadFairGoodExcellent O(log n), O(1)O(n)O(n log n)O(n^2)O(2^n)O(n!)OperationsElements Common Data Structure Operations Data StructureTime ComplexitySpace Complexity AverageWorstWorst AccessSearchInsertionDeletionAccessSearchInsertionDeletion ...